Travel Through Africa With EbonyLife TV; Destinations Africa – Including Ghana

EbonyLife TV, brings you Destinations Africa, a show designed for the African traveler, highlighting the continent’s top tourist destinations.

What sets this travel series apart? It explores our own backyard the way the African traveler would experience their ideal vacation. In each episode presenter, Nigerian TV personality Mimi Onalaja, meets a local host and together they explore the country’s top-end attractions, rich history, authentic treasures, culinary delights and some unexpected gems.

Join Miss Seychelles 2014, Camila Estico and together with Mimi as they guide you through Mahé and La Digue’s beaches, Rum tastings, shopping, nightlife and eco highlights, in beautiful Seychelles.


The 30 minute, 12 part series airs its SEYCHELLES episode on EbonyLife TV DStv channel 165 on Saturday, 14 May at 4:30pm, Sunday 15 May 7:30pm and Tuesday 17 May at 8:00pm.


Some of the featured destinations include: Kenya, Seychelles, Mauritius, Tanzania, Zambia, Ghana, The Gambia, Senegal, Ethiopia, Cote d’Ivoire and Nigeria.

Photos : Bacchus Energy Drink Launched In Ghana With Efya’s Album Listening Session

Bragha (GH) LTD, a wholly Ghanaian owned company trading in Fast Moving Consumer Goods for the past ten  years in Ghana had added Bacchus Energy Drink to its wide  range of commercial products in Ghana, and the West African sub-region.  The drink was launched at a special listening session of Efya’s debut album, ‘Janesis’ on Friday night (26th Feburay , 2016).  Ghanaian songbird Jane Awindor popularly known in showbiz as Efya on Friday received good ratings for the album which will be out before April. The album features renowned African artistes like Stonebwoy, E.L, Ice Prince and many others.  Bacchus energy drink is a premium non-alcoholic beverage produced in Korea and now available in Ghana. It is formulated with Korean ginseng extracts, taurine, royal jelly, multi-vitamin B complex, inositol, apple juice and other ingredients which are intended to provide  instant energy.

PEACE HYDE WINS BIG! FIRST GHANAIAN AWARDED AS AFRICAN BROADCASTER OF THE YEAR

Ghana’s Peace Hyde has once again put Ghana on the map by winning the African Broadcaster of the year award in the Nigerian Broadcasters Merit Awards 2016.  Peace recently made history by becoming the first Ghanaian to secure the coveted position of Forbes Africa Correspondent, a role which sees her representing the West African region for the prestigious leading business magazine. By Far the most hotly contested category in the award show was the African Broadcaster of the Year female people’s choice category, which saw Ghana’s Peace Hyde emerge as the winner.  The Forbes Africa Correspondent and Media Personality won against heavy weights like South Africa’s Bonang Matheba, Nigeria’s Dolapo Oni and Stephanie Coker.
